+ | [title] Preparation |
---|---|
+ | [* black] First, we will want to make sure that you are working in a well-lit space and have an area to catch any of the screws that you will remove |
+ | [* black] Make sure to have a small Philips screwdriver like the J000 in the iFixit Pro Tech Toolkit |
+ | [* black] Lastly, you will need to make sure your have a pair of tweezers (recommended) or a thumbtack to remove the latch for the battery |
